Neuropathy, ulceration, infection and Charcot — structured limb-salvage pathway
Diabetic foot disease affects up to 25% of people with diabetes during their lifetime and is the leading cause of non-traumatic lower-limb amputation. At Dr. Bodh Raj’s clinic, diabetic foot management follows a structured limb-salvage pathway: risk stratification (monofilament testing, vibration sense, ankle-brachial index), wound classification (Wagner or University of Texas system), infection control (IDSA/IWGDF criteria), offloading, vascular assessment, and multidisciplinary coordination with endocrinology, vascular surgery, and podiatry.

Diabetic foot pathology arises from the convergence of peripheral neuropathy (loss of protective sensation), peripheral arterial disease (ischaemia), and immunopathy (impaired wound healing and infection resistance). The insensate foot develops callus over pressure points, which ulcerates, becomes infected, and may progress to osteomyelitis and gangrene if not identified early. Charcot neuroarthropathy — acute joint destruction in a neuropathic foot — is a limb-threatening emergency that must be differentiated from infection or simple sprain.
Management begins with risk stratification and patient education on daily foot inspection, appropriate footwear, and when to seek emergency care. Active ulcers are treated with wound bed preparation (debridement, moisture balance, infection control), offloading (total contact casting or irremovable walkers), and vascular assessment when perfusion is inadequate. Infection is managed with the IDSA/IWGDF framework: mild (oral antibiotics), moderate (IV antibiotics plus surgical debridement), severe (urgent surgical drainage and possible amputation). Charcot is treated with immediate immobilization and extended non-weight-bearing.
